The Table Grapes Breeding Program of the National Institute of Agricultural Technology (INTA), Argentina, has developed eight seedless cultivars: Delicia INTA, Fernandina INTA, Serena INTA, Sorpresa INTA, Revelación INTA, Esperanza INTA, Resistencia INTA and Grandeza INTA. Between 2016 and 2018 these cultivars were registered in the National Cultivar Registry of the Argentina National Seed Institute. In subsequent production cycles, before registration, organoleptic and agronomic characters and various management practices effects were assessed. Likewise, postharvest performance was analyzed to determine export potential. The cultivars produce berries of 18 to 22 mm diameter. Forty-five days after cold storage, they still show acceptable values of shattering, firmness, and stem browning. Delicia INTA is a late-harvest variety, with pink berries and an intense muscatel flavor. Fernadina INTA, Sorpresa INTA, and Revelación INTA open the possibility of exporting black grapes. Sorpresa INTA stands out for the large size and unique flavor of its berries, while Fernandina INTA and Revelación INTA, late harvest varieties, do so due to their capacity to support a high crop load without losing quality. Serena INTA produces firm red grapes as Crimson Seedless variety, but the harvest is before, which allows for the expansion of the seasonal availability of this type of grapes. Esperanza INTA, Grandeza INTA (early harvest), and Resistencia INTA (late harvest) are White varieties. Esperanza INTA and Grandeza INTA are characterized by obtaining large berries.
